 · Your student loan lender determines your Income-Based Repayment payment. If you don’t make enough money based on their guidelines, you may have a $0 payment right now. As long as you can provide proof that the payment is $0 and it’s official proof from the lender, your mortgage lender can use $0, which won’t affect your debt ratio.

Differences Between FHA , VA, CONVENTIONAL , USDA Mortgage Loans A conventional mortgage is a home loan that isn’t guaranteed or insured by the federal government. conventional mortgages that conform to the requirements set forth by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ac typically require down payments of at least 3%. Borrowers who put at least 20% down do not have to pay mortgage insurance.
